Fun Activities for Double Play in Addition



There are countless activities that can help children practice addition while having fun. Here are some engaging ideas:

1. Addition Relay Races



Set up a relay race where children must solve addition problems to move forward. Divide them into teams and create a series of addition problems they must solve before passing the baton to the next teammate. This promotes teamwork and encourages quick thinking.

2. Math Scavenger Hunt



Create a scavenger hunt where each clue involves solving an addition problem. For example, children might need to find a specific number of items based on the answer to an addition problem. This not only reinforces addition skills but also makes learning active and dynamic.

3. Board Games with an Addition Twist



Use popular board games like Monopoly or Snakes and Ladders and incorporate additional math challenges. For example, every time a player lands on a property, they must solve an addition problem to determine how much rent to pay or collect.

4. Arts and Crafts Projects



Combine creativity with math by having kids create addition art projects. For instance, they can use colored beads to represent numbers and create patterns that require them to add up the total number of beads used.

5. Digital Learning Games



There are numerous online platforms and apps that offer interactive addition games. Websites like ABCmouse and Cool Math Games provide a variety of activities tailored for different age groups, making learning accessible and fun.

Benefits of Double Play Monkeying Around with Addition



Incorporating double play into addition lessons has several benefits that extend beyond just mastering math skills.

1. Enhanced Engagement



Children are naturally drawn to play. By integrating games and interactive activities into learning, they are more likely to participate actively and stay focused during lessons.

2. Improved Retention



When children learn through play, they tend to remember concepts better. The combination of movement, visual aids, and hands-on activities creates strong neural connections that facilitate recall.

3. Development of Critical Thinking Skills



Many playful addition activities require children to think critically and solve problems. This fosters their ability to analyze situations and make informed decisions, which are essential skills in mathematics and life.

4. Encouragement of a Positive Attitude Towards Math



By making addition fun, children are less likely to develop math anxiety. They associate learning with enjoyment, which can lead to a lifelong appreciation for mathematics.

5. Social Skills Development



Many double play activities are designed for group participation, promoting social interaction and teamwork. Children learn to communicate, cooperate, and resolve conflicts while working towards a common goal.

Tips for Implementing Double Play Monkeying Around with Addition



To effectively incorporate double play in teaching addition, consider the following tips:

1. Know Your Audience



Tailor activities to the age and skill level of the children. Younger children might enjoy simpler games, while older kids may appreciate more complex challenges.

2. Use a Variety of Materials



Incorporate different types of materials and resources, such as manipulatives, digital tools, and art supplies, to keep activities fresh and exciting.

3. Be Flexible



Be open to adapting activities based on children's interests and responses. If a particular game isn't resonating, feel free to modify it or switch to something else.

4. Encourage Collaboration



Promote teamwork by encouraging children to work together. This not only enhances their social skills but also allows them to learn from one another.

5. Celebrate Success



Acknowledge children's efforts and successes, no matter how small. Positive reinforcement boosts their confidence and motivates them to continue learning.
